The Formula: How Seconds to Days Conversion Works
The conversion from seconds to days is based on a simple and universally recognized formula. Understanding this formula can help you appreciate the calculation and even perform it manually if needed.
There are 24 hours in a day, 60 minutes in an hour, and 60 seconds in a minute. To find the total number of seconds in one day, you multiply these values together:
24 hours/day × 60 minutes/hour × 60 seconds/minute = 86,400 seconds/day
Therefore, to convert any given number of seconds to days, you simply divide the total seconds by 86,400.
Days = Total Seconds / 86,400
For example, if you want to convert 1,000,000 seconds to days:
1,000,000 seconds / 86,400 = 11.574 days (approximately)

2. Technology and Software Engineering
In the world of computing, time is often measured in seconds or milliseconds since a specific point in time (like the Unix epoch). System administrators and DevOps engineers use the seconds to days conversion to monitor server uptime, analyze log files, and set expiration dates for security tokens or SSL certificates. For example, a server's uptime might be reported as 2,592,000 seconds. Converting this to 30 days provides a much clearer picture of its stability and maintenance cycle.

- How many seconds are in a day?
- There are exactly 86,400 seconds in one day (24 hours x 60 minutes x 60 seconds).
- What is a decimal day?
- A decimal day represents a fraction of a day. For example, 0.5 days is exactly half a day, or 12 hours. This format is much easier to use in calculations and spreadsheets than the traditional days, hours, and minutes format.
